Primality and Factorization

388689 is a composite number, meaning it has divisors other than 1 and itself. Specifically, 388689 has 16 divisors: 1, 3, 7, 21, 83, 223, 249, 581, 669, 1561, 1743, 4683, 18509, 55527, 129563, 388689. The sum of its proper divisors (all divisors except 388689 itself) is 213423, which makes 388689 a deficient number, since 213423 < 388689. Most integers are deficient — the sum of their proper divisors falls short of the number itself.

The prime factorization of 388689 is 3 × 7 × 83 × 223. Prime factorization is essential for computing the greatest common divisor (GCD) and least common multiple (LCM), simplifying fractions, and solving problems in modular arithmetic. The nearest primes to 388689 are 388673 and 388691.

Digit Properties

The digits of 388689 sum to 42, and its digital root (the single-digit value obtained by repeatedly summing digits) is 6. The number 388689 has 6 digits in its decimal representation. Digit sums are fundamental to divisibility tests: a number is divisible by 3 if and only if its digit sum is divisible by 3, and the same holds for divisibility by 9. The digital root, also known as the repeated digital sum, has applications in casting out nines — a centuries-old technique for verifying arithmetic calculations.

Collatz Conjecture

The Collatz conjecture (also known as the 3n + 1 problem) is one of the most famous unsolved problems in mathematics. Starting from 388689 and repeatedly applying the rule — divide by 2 if even, multiply by 3 and add 1 if odd — the sequence reaches 1 in 148 steps. Despite its simplicity, no one has been able to prove that this process always terminates for every starting number, and the conjecture remains open since it was first proposed by Lothar Collatz in 1937.
